FETE’s Existential Encounter with Nataly Pushkareva

our third #existentialencounter held on Monday 18th March 2024 with Nataly Pushkareva, practicing existential therapist, who will be talking about “Experience working with family archives in existential counseling and psychotherapy”. The lecture presents the experience of studying family history in existential counseling and psychotherapy. Work on the project “Memory of Future Generations“ as a search for supports and meanings in the face of uncertainty. In a situation of crises, challenges, and uncertainties, the topic of working with family archives becomes a resource. Nataly is a practicing existential therapist, MIEK trainer, deputy head of the MIEK council for academic work, and a voting member of FETE. Full member of NGO “ National Association of Existential Counselors and Therapists “(NOECT) and NUO “All-Russian Professional Psychotherapeutic League“ (OPPL); and she is an Author of publications in journals of international Russian-language journal “ Existential Tradition: Philosophy, Psychology, Psychotherapy”,
